Poisonous Plants are enemies from MediEvil. They can be found in The Enchanted Earth level.

Involvement

Poisonous Plants are magical flowers encountered in the Enchanted Forest. There are two types:

Pod Spitter

The most common type of the plants. They can spit at Daniel with purple fireballs if he approaches.

Gobber

Very rare variation of the plants, since four are only four of them. They'll fire green fireballs with spout-shaped pedals at Daniel.
